Traditional Chinese medicine has unique advantages in treating many diseases, but in the treatment of cancer, it still depends on the combination of Chinese and Western medicine to achieve the best therapeutic effect. Let's take a look at the advantages of traditional Chinese medicine in treating liver cancer. Liver cancer is a complex disease that occurs after many factors have been involved for many years. It is also quite difficult to treat. The choice of treatment method cannot be single. The best is to combine multiple methods for treatment. Advantages of traditional Chinese medicine in treating liver cancer: 1. Relieve the condition: It is very common to use traditional Chinese medicine in the treatment of liver cancer. First of all, we must treat the symptoms of the tumor, so that the patient's clinical discomfort symptoms can be improved in time, enhance the body's immune ability, and reduce the patient's pain. 2. Improve living standards: During the treatment of liver cancer, patients are prone to physical weakness, decreased appetite, and poor mental state after suffering from the disease. Therefore, we must use traditional Chinese medicine to improve the current situation, improve the patient's quality of life, and reduce the occurrence of adverse symptoms. The following is the classification and treatment of liver cancer: (1) Qi stagnation and blood stasis treatment: activate blood circulation and remove blood stasis, promote qi and eliminate accumulation. Prescription: 10g each of Bupleurum, Scutellaria, White Peony, Curcuma, Semen Persicae, Rhizoma Atractylodis Macrocephalae, Radix Rhizoma Rhei, Radix Notoginseng (pre-decocted), 15g of Curcuma, Scutellariae Scutellariae, Carapace of Biejia (pre-decocted), 30g each of Scutellariae Scutellariae, Carapace of Biejia (pre-decocted). Additions and subtractions: If there are symptoms of heat such as red urine and constipation, add Herba Pinelliae, Herba Hedyotis Diffusae, and Herba Solanume; if there are symptoms such as greasy tongue coating, slippery or moist pulse, chest tightness and nausea, add Herba Pinelliae, Herba Poriae, and Herba Junchene. Usage: 1 dose per day, decocted in water, taken in 2 doses. Commonly used prescriptions: Xuefu Zhuyu Decoction, Rhubarb and Wormwood Pills, Yunnan Baiyao. (2) Treatment of damp-heat accumulation of toxins: detoxify and purge fire, clear the liver and gallbladder. Prescription: 9g each of Herba Junchene, Gardenia, Scutellaria, Sophora flavescens, Curcuma, and Rhizoma Curcumae, 30g each of Scutellariae Scutellariae, Herba Hedyotis Diffusae, and Herba Pinelliae. Add or subtract: For dull pain in the liver area, dizziness and dry eyes, add Chinese Angelica, White Peony Root, and Chuanxiong; for ascites, add Plantago, Alisma, and Ascites Grass. Usage: 1 dose per day, decocted in water, taken in 2 doses. Commonly used prescriptions: Junchenhao Decoction, Niuhuang Xingxiao Pills. (3) Treatment for liver and kidney yin deficiency: nourish the liver and kidney, remove blood stasis and eliminate symptoms. Prescription: 20g each of Radix Rehmanniae, Carapax Trichosanthis (pre-decocted), 15g each of Fructus Ligustri Lucidi, Herba Ecliptae, White Peony Root, Cortex Moutan, Fructus Corni, and Salvia Miltiorrhiza, 10g each of American ginseng (stewed separately), 30g each of Scutellaria barbata and Polygonum multiflorum. Add or subtract: For abdominal distension, add Rhizoma Chuanxiong and Cortex Moutan; for bleeding tendency, add American ginseng, and add Herba Agrimoniae and raw lotus root juice. Usage: 1 dose per day, decocted in water, taken in 2 doses. Commonly used prescriptions: Zishui Qinggan Yin, Erzhi Pills. (4) Treatment for spleen deficiency and dampness: invigorate the spleen and replenish qi, remove dampness and eliminate distension. Prescription: 20g of Codonopsis pilosula, 15g each of Atractylodes macrocephala, Poria cocos, and Crataegus pinnatifida, 5g of Tangerine peel, 10g of Faban, 18g of Salvia miltiorrhiza, 30g each of Coix seeds, Cynanchum indica, Hedyotis diffusa, and Achyranthes bidentata. Add or subtract: For fever with profuse sweating, add Baihu decoction; for constipation and abdominal distension, add Chengqi decoction; for pain in the liver area, add Chuanlianzi, Corydalis, or white peony root and licorice. Usage: 1 dose per day, decocted in water, divided into 2 times. Commonly used prescriptions: Xiangsha Liujunzi Decoction, Buzhong Yiqi Decoction, and Sijunzi Decoction. |
